" Mind Over Murder " is a cornerstone episode from the debut season of Family Guy , originally airing on April 25, 1999. It perfectly encapsulates the early chaotic energy of the Griffin household while laying the groundwork for the show’s signature surrealism. Watching "Mind Over Murder" today offers a nostalgic look at the series before it became a global juggernaut. The character designs are slightly cruder, and the humor is a bit more structured, but the core dynamic—Peter’s impulsiveness versus Stewie’s world-dominating intellect—is already fully formed.
